Instructions
 

  • SHORTCUT - Use a Devil's Food Cake box mix instead of making cake from scratch
  • CAKE
  • Grease a 9X9 inch baking pan
  • In a medium sized bowl, whisk flour, cocoa powder, baking soda and salt together and set aside
  • In a stand mixer, cream the but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
  • Add the e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ition, and then add the vanilla
  • Mix in the dry ingredients and milk alternating between each one(two additions each)
  • Beat for 1-2 minutes
  • Pour the batter into the prepared pan
  • Bake in the oven at 350 degrees for 35-40 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ean from the center
  • Allow the cake to completely cool before adding the cream filling
  • CREAM FILLING
  • Meanwhile, start the filling. Whisk together the flour and cold milk in a saucepan over low-medium heat. Continuously whisk, until it just starts to thicken up. You want to watch it closely and continuing whisking. If it starts to become lumpy you've cooked it too long. Quickly remove from the heat, transfer to a bowl and set aside until fully cooled.
  • Add butter, sugar and vanilla to a stand mixer with the whisk attachment and, and beat 2-3 minutes until fully combined. Add the cooled flour mixture and beat for additional or 4 minutes until smooth and fluffy.
  • Spread onto the cooled cake and refrigerate for 1-2 hours
  • Icing
  • In a medium saucepan over low heat, melt butter, remove from heat and allow to slightly cool. Add remaining ingredients and pour over the top of the cake, and refrigerate
  • Gluten-Free Option:To make this Old Fashioned Ho Ho Cake gluten-free, substitute the all-purpose flour in the cake with a 1:1 gluten-free baking flour (such as Bob’s Red Mill 1:1 Gluten-Free Baking Flour).For the cream filling, use ¼ cup gluten-free flour or 3 tablespoons cornstarch in place of the all-purpose flour.No changes are needed for the frosting.
